Through agricultural education, students are provided opportunities for leadership development, personal growth and career success.
Its purpose is to deliver instruction through three major components:
1) classroom/laboratory instruction (contextual learning)
2) supervised agricultural experience programs (work-based learning)
3) student leadership organizations (National FFA Organization).
It prepares students for successful careers and a
lifetime of informed choices in the global agriculture, food, fiber and
natural resources systems.
